  • ModerateFDA (Devices)·Z-1820-2012·2012-06-27

    NIMS Recalls Exer-Rest Brochures for Unsubstantiated Claims

    Non-Invasive Monitoring Systems, Inc. is voluntarily recalling 91 Exer-Rest marketing brochures nationwide because they contain unsubstantiated health claims.

  • ModerateFDA (Devices)·Z-1819-2012·2012-06-27

    NIMS Recalls Exer-Rest Brochures for Unsubstantiated Claims

    Non-Invasive Monitoring Systems is voluntarily recalling 3,665 Exer-Rest marketing brochures nationwide because they contain unsubstantiated health claims.
